Getting from Izmir Airport (ADB) to central Izmir
Izmir Airport is approximately 18 kilometres from the centre of Izmir. Driving there takes about 30 minutes.
Travelling to the centre on public transport takes around 35 minutes.
When to fly to Izmir Airport (ADB)
The quietest month for a flight from Los Angeles International Airport to Izmir Airport is March, while August is the busiest. Choose the best time to go to Izmir based on whether you prefer a more relaxed vibe or a faster pace.
Before locking in your flight from Los Angeles International Airport to Izmir Airport, consider the kind of weather you enjoy. July is the warmest month in Izmir, with temperatures ranging from 21ºC (70ºF) to 38ºC (100ºF).
If you'd rather travel in cooler conditions, look for a cheap ticket from LAX to ADB in January. Temperatures average between 2ºC (36ºF) and 15ºC (59ºF) then.
